Lines Matching refs:pt

101 	struct nvme_pt_command	pt;  in read_controller_data()  local
103 memset(&pt, 0, sizeof(pt)); in read_controller_data()
104 pt.cmd.opc = NVME_OPC_IDENTIFY; in read_controller_data()
105 pt.cmd.cdw10 = htole32(1); in read_controller_data()
106 pt.buf = cdata; in read_controller_data()
107 pt.len = sizeof(*cdata); in read_controller_data()
108 pt.is_read = 1; in read_controller_data()
110 if (ioctl(fd, NVME_PASSTHROUGH_CMD, &pt) < 0) in read_controller_data()
116 if (nvme_completion_is_error(&pt.cpl)) in read_controller_data()
124 struct nvme_pt_command pt; in read_namespace_data() local
126 memset(&pt, 0, sizeof(pt)); in read_namespace_data()
127 pt.cmd.opc = NVME_OPC_IDENTIFY; in read_namespace_data()
128 pt.cmd.nsid = htole32(nsid); in read_namespace_data()
129 pt.cmd.cdw10 = htole32(0); in read_namespace_data()
130 pt.buf = nsdata; in read_namespace_data()
131 pt.len = sizeof(*nsdata); in read_namespace_data()
132 pt.is_read = 1; in read_namespace_data()
134 if (ioctl(fd, NVME_PASSTHROUGH_CMD, &pt) < 0) in read_namespace_data()
140 if (nvme_completion_is_error(&pt.cpl)) in read_namespace_data()
148 struct nvme_pt_command pt; in read_active_namespaces() local
150 memset(&pt, 0, sizeof(pt)); in read_active_namespaces()
151 pt.cmd.opc = NVME_OPC_IDENTIFY; in read_active_namespaces()
152 pt.cmd.nsid = htole32(nsid); in read_active_namespaces()
153 pt.cmd.cdw10 = htole32(2); in read_active_namespaces()
154 pt.buf = nslist; in read_active_namespaces()
155 pt.len = sizeof(*nslist); in read_active_namespaces()
156 pt.is_read = 1; in read_active_namespaces()
158 if (ioctl(fd, NVME_PASSTHROUGH_CMD, &pt) < 0) in read_active_namespaces()
164 if (nvme_completion_is_error(&pt.cpl)) in read_active_namespaces()